Put it this way, if it took the guys a long time agonising over the final tracklisting, that means there are more tracks that were fully formed, recorded and mixed which didn't make the album (than just "Moving To Mars").

 

In the Viva era, instead of doing b-sides, we got the "offcuts" from VLVODAHF in the guise of the Prospekt's March EP

 

1. LiT II

2. Postcards From Far Away

3. Glass Of Water

4. Rainy Day (is "School" basically the first couple of minutes from Death And All His Friends, plus Rainy Day?)

5. Prospekt's March/Poppyfields

6. Now My Feet Won't Touch The Ground

 

So, assuming there is five or six completed tracks which were in the running for inclusion on Mylo Xyloto and we have only heard one of them ("Moving To Mars"), then I would like to think we are in for a treat with the single releases of "Charlie Brown" and a likely fourth single.

 

Quite possibly (and hopefully) "Car Kids" will be one of the tracks...
